Storing barbering tools properly is crucial for maintaining their quality, functionality, and hygiene. The most effective method involves using a sanitized holder. This approach ensures that the tools are not only organized but also kept in a clean space that minimizes the risk of contamination. A sanitized holder prevents the growth of bacteria and other pathogens, which is essential in maintaining the health and safety of both the barber and clients.

Using a sanitized holder also allows for easy access to the tools while ensuring they are protected from environmental contaminants, such as hair clippings or dust that could accumulate in a less organized setting. Additionally, proper storage in a sanitized environment helps prolong the lifespan of the tools by protecting them from damage that could occur in neglectful conditions.

Other methods of storage, such as storing in a clean and dry manner, while important, do not provide the same level of protection from contamination that a sanitized holder would. Cluttering tools can lead to potential accidents and make it difficult to find items quickly when needed. Additionally, storing tools in a wet and damp area is highly detrimental, as it can promote rust and damage to the tools over time.
